The connection between ISO compliance and document management software
ISO compliance is rooted in structured processes, traceability, and accountability. From standard operating procedures to training manuals, every document must follow strict version control and approval workflows. Document Management Software ensures that organizations can manage these requirements seamlessly.
For example, ISO 13485 for medical devices requires companies to maintain a comprehensive quality management framework with controlled documents for design controls, production processes, and post-market surveillance. A robust Document Management System allows manufacturers to manage these documents digitally, reducing manual errors and ensuring timely updates. By leveraging DMS Software, enterprises can demonstrate compliance with regulatory bodies during audits and inspections with ease.

Document management software as the foundation for ISO-driven training programs
ISO standards emphasize not just documented processes but also employee awareness and competence. Document Management Software enables organizations to link training directly with documents. For example, when a new standard operating procedure is approved, the system automatically assigns related training tasks to employees.
A Document Management System ensures that employees acknowledge and complete required training within defined timelines, creating a record of compliance. In industries like medical devices and high-tech manufacturing, where regulatory scrutiny is intense, this integration of training and document control through DMS Software ensures that ISO requirements are met at every level of the workforce.
